1. 首页
  2. 数据库
  3. 其它
  4. PSsimplesafeint:遵循MISRA C ++规则的安全(环绕)整数的C ++ 20实现 源码

PSsimplesafeint:遵循MISRA C ++规则的安全(环绕)整数的C ++ 20实现 源码

上传者: 2021-04-29 15:43:59上传 ZIP文件 75.18KB 热度 8次
简易安全 遵循MISRA C ++规则的安全(环绕)整数的C ++ 20实现。 #ifdef ed C ++ 17实现在分支C ++ 17中可用。 它在namspace psssint提供以下类型,并在namespace psssint::literals提供相应的UDL运算符: // unsigned enum class ui8 ; auto a = 1_ui8; enum class ui16 ; auto b = 2_ui16; enum class ui32 ; auto c = 3_ui32; enum class ui64 ; auto d = 4_ui64; // signed enum class si8 ; auto e = 5_si8; enum class si16 ; auto f = 6_si16; enum class si32 ; a
下载地址
用户评论